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.05.18;
Скачать: CL | DM;

Вниз

добавление файлов в проект   Найти похожие ветки 

 
Aleksandrrr   (2008-04-16 09:47) [0]

Здравствуйте. Просьба помочь в таком вопросе.
Пишу программку, которая запускает bat - файлы. Этих файлов уйма.
Подскажите, можно ли добавить все эти bat -файлы в исполняемый файл, и из него их вызывать?
Если можно, просьба привести пример.


 
Ega23 ©   (2008-04-16 09:52) [1]

пишешь ещё один bat, который запускает эти bat-ы.


 
Riply ©   (2008-04-16 09:54) [2]

> [1] Ega23 ©   (16.04.08 09:52)
> пишешь ещё один bat, который запускает эти bat-ы.

А потом пишешь батник, который запускает тот батник, который запускает эти bat-ы  :)


 
Aleksandrrr   (2008-04-16 09:58) [3]

Нет, мне нужно, чтобы все батники были в одном файле - в моем приложении. Можно ли так сделать?


 
DrPass ©   (2008-04-16 10:09) [4]

Поместить их в ресурсы твоего приложения. Перед исполнением доставать из ресурсов, сохранять на диск, исполнять, удалять. Если тебе, конечно, нужно именно "хранить батники в приложении", а не просто обойтись без кучи файлов


 
Рамиль ©   (2008-04-16 10:10) [5]

Ну, добавь в ресурсы, выгружай в %Temp% и запускай.


 
Сергей М. ©   (2008-04-16 10:10) [6]


> мне нужно, чтобы все батники были в одном файле


Засунь их содержимое в ресурсы своего exe-файла.


 
Anatoly Podgoretsky ©   (2008-04-16 10:13) [7]

> Aleksandrrr  (16.04.2008 09:47:00)  [0]

Если ты хочешь в проект, то бат файлы совсем не нужны, пересылай все эти строки командному процессору, через ShellExecute например, не говоря уже о более сложных методах, как перенаправление стандартных потоков ввода-вывода.
Синтаксис ShellExecute хорошо описан в справке.


 
Ega23 ©   (2008-04-16 10:21) [8]


> А потом пишешь батник, который запускает тот батник, который
> запускает эти bat-ы  :)
>


Конечно. :)
Есть приложение, которое запускает cmd с параметрами, которрый запускает либо isql, либо psql, либо другие cmd, которые запускают либо isql либо psql.
:)


 
Aleksandrrr   (2008-04-16 14:05) [9]

Спасибо за направление!



Страницы: 1 вся ветка

Текущий архив: 2008.05.18;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.022 c
4-1189112766
Rubi
2007-09-07 01:06
2008.05.18
Отправка 1 байта через com-порт


2-1208344255
lewka-serdceed
2008-04-16 15:10
2008.05.18
Ошибка "Invalid variant operation"


2-1208778084
incm
2008-04-21 15:41
2008.05.18
Как нарисовать линию точками


15-1207547497
Slider007
2008-04-07 09:51
2008.05.18
С днем рождения ! 7 апреля 2008 понедельник


3-1197011406
Свой
2007-12-07 10:10
2008.05.18
Получение данных полсле запроса от TQuery